Meet your guide outside the Library of Congress and begin your adventure. We head to the Supreme Court (exterior only) for a photo stop where your guide will discuss the complex history of the institution, notable justices, landmark cases, and the secrets of the building. Next we head to the US Capitol where your guide will give you background about the heart of American democracy and fill you in on the little-known history and stories before providing passes to a tour of the historic rooms of the Capitol. Finally we take a tunnel to the Library of Congress, the world's largest library. Your guide's reserved passes will bring you into the heart of knowledge. You will see Thomas Jefferson's library and see the grandeur of the Main Reading Room.

Stop At: U.S. Capitol
Washington DC, District of Columbia
The Capitol is among the most architecturally impressive and symbolically important buildings in the world. The Senate and the House of Representatives have met here for more than two centuries. Begun in 1793, the Capitol has been built, burnt, rebuilt, extended, and restored; today, it stands as a monument not only to its builders but also to the American people and their government. Enjoy a reserved tour of the rotunda, crypt, and old house chambers led by a US Capitol Guide.

RESTRICTED ITEMS
The following items are strictly prohibited in the US Capitol:
• Liquid, including water
• Food or beverages of any kind, including fruit and unopened packaged food
• Aerosol containers
• Non-aerosol spray (Prescriptions for medical needs are permitted.)
• Any pointed object, e.g. knitting needles and letter openers (Pens and pencils are permitted.)
• Any bag larger than 18" wide x 14" high x 8.5" deep
• Electric stun guns, martial arts weapons or devices
• Guns, replica guns, ammunition, and fireworks
• Knives of any size
• Mace and pepper spray
• Razors and box cutters
*There are no storage lockers on site for any bags or items that you cannot bring in.
